RTS is an enthusiast culture company that builds at the intersection of gaming, creators, and brands. From global live events to bespoke branded content, we exist to create meaningful connections between fans and the worlds they love. Our team brings deep expertise across partnership sales and marketing, talent management, event production, media, community building, and IP development.About Evo:For over 20 years, The Evolution Championship Series (Evo), has produced the largest and longest-running fighting game tournament conventions in the world. Our events are rallying points where fans, publishers, developers, and brands celebrate fighting games and the communities that love them. Beyond our established live events, Evo’s mission continues to evolve to create, celebrate, and renew fighting game fandom.Role OverviewWe’re hiring a Product Manager to help define and build new products at Evo, with an initial focus on Evo Legends.This is a product role first. You’ll set direction, prioritize work, and drive execution across a mix of live, content, and fan-facing experiences.Your primary focus will be Evo Special Events, including traveling live events built around exhibition matches, player storytelling, and fan experiences (E.g. Evo Legends and Evo Showcases). You’ll be responsible for shaping how this product is defined, how it shows up in different markets, and how it evolves over time. At the same time, you’ll be expected to think more broadly about how Evo builds and scales products that serve players, organizers, and fans. This will include consumer experiences across both internally and externally produced events and programming.This role requires strong judgment, comfort with ambiguity, and the ability to move between strategy and execution.Key ResponsibilitiesProduct Strategy and OwnershipDefine product goals, priorities, and success metricsBuild and maintain a roadmap across multiple initiativesMake tradeoffs across features, formats, and investmentsUse data, feedback, and judgment to guide decisionsCross-Functional ExecutionLead execution across Product, Operations, Marketing, Partnerships, Creative, Content, and BroadcastAlign stakeholders on priorities, scope, and timelinesDrive work forward across teams and remove blockersEnsure decisions are made and progress is consistentExecution and DeliveryBreak down product work into clear plans and deliverablesManage timelines across multiple workstreamsIdentify risks early and adjust as neededEnsure a high standard of quality across outputsBudget Ownership and Performance TrackingOwn and manage budgets across your product areasAllocate resources across events, content, and production based on prioritiesTrack spend and performance against planEvaluate outcomes and adjust investment over timeProduct Development (Primary Focus: Special Events)Lead development of Evo Legends and Evo Showcase as repeatable products across marketsDefine event structures, formats, and core components of the experiencesShape how exhibition matches, local competitions, fan elements, and new content promotions come togetherEnsure the products are clear, compelling, and consistent across regionsContent and Experience DesignDefine how storytelling, matchups, and player narratives are developedWork with teams to build content that supports each event, including promotional and broadcast contentEnsure the experience works both on-site and for broadcast audiencesSystems and Process DesignBuild repeatable processes for planning and executing events across regionsCreate documentation and workflows that support scaleImprove how teams collaborate and deliver over timeUser Insight and FeedbackStay close to players, talent, and fansGather feedback and translate it into product improvementsIdentify patterns across markets and adjust the approach accordinglyLaunch and IterationSupport launch and rollout of Legends events across regionsMeasure performance across attendance, engagement, and viewershipIterate on format, content, and experience based on resultsQualifications5+ years of experience in product management, or a related role with clear product ownershipExperience building and shipping products, programs, or live experiencesExperience owning budgets and making investment decisionsStrong ability to prioritize and make decisions with limited informationClear communicator who can align cross-functional teamsStrong project management and organizational skillsComfortable working in a fast-paced, remote environmentInterest in gaming, live events, or content-driven productsBonus PointsExperience working on live events, broadcast, or content productionExperience working with talent, creators, or competitive playersBackground in esports or gamingExperience building repeatable event formats across marketsExisting connections in the FGC or gaming communityA practical understanding of frame dataBenefitsMedical, Dental, Vision and Life Insurance401(k) plan available for employee contributionsFlexible work scheduleGenerous PTO and company-observed holidaysRemote-first culture
